移動DVD液晶屏驅動電路供電原理分析 移動DVD是如何供電的

原理分析

移動DVD機(ji),受其(qi)(qi)體積(ji)限(xian)制,外接電(dian)(dian)池電(dian)(dian)壓大多為(wei)9V左(zuo)右(you),但其(qi)(qi)液晶(jing)屏驅動部(bu)分,需要(yao)多組(zu)不(bu)同的電(dian)(dian)壓,因此移動DVD機(ji)液晶(jing)屏驅動部(bu)分的供電(dian)(dian)電(dian)(dian)路相對較為(wei)復雜,故障率(lv)也較高(gao)。附圖(tu)為(wei)新科SDP1710型移動DVD機(ji)液晶(jing)屏驅動部(bu)分電(dian)(dian)路圖(tu)。

此電路(lu)(lu)(lu)為液晶屏驅動(dong)(dong)供電電路(lu)(lu)(lu)(又稱二次(ci)升壓電路(lu)(lu)(lu))。因彩色TFT顯示屏播放視(shi)頻(pin)圖像時(shi),要求(qiu)有快速響(xiang)應時(shi)間,對于控制電路(lu)(lu)(lu),意(yi)味著要加上更(geng)高的(de)驅動(dong)(dong)電壓;TFT屏的(de)非(fei)晶薄膜晶體管的(de)閾(yu)值電壓較高,輸入的(de)信(xin)號有的(de)高達(da)(da)20V。而此電壓作(zuo)為便捷式產(chan)品,一般難以達(da)(da)到要求(qiu),故需要通過升壓電路(lu)(lu)(lu)來變換。
